The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.
In the 1881 Census, the household of Smith Lambert, born in 1851 in Bradford, Yorkshire, consisted of 3 members. Smith was the head of the household, married to Mary Lambert, born in 1843 in Bramley, Yorkshire, England.
During the period, also present in the household was Smith's Sister In Law, Elizabeth Bruce, born in 1846 in Bramley, Yorkshire, England.
